ABOUT SUPERCARS
Supercars is Australia and New Zealand's motorsport legacy. For decades, we've been the proving ground where legends are made—from Brock and Moffat to Lowndes and Whincup. We've created iconic rivalries, unforgettable moments, and a distinct brand of racing that's captured the hearts of generations. Our history is woven into the fabric of sport and culture across both nations.
Today, the Repco Supercars Championship stands as the premier touring car category in Australasia and one of the most competitive motorsport series globally. With close racing, diverse circuits from street tracks to legendary permanent venues, and a commitment to parity that ensures anyone can win on any given day, we've built a championship that's recognised worldwide for its entertainment value and sporting integrity. We're one of the most watched and attended sports in the region.

ROLE SUMMARY
The Marketing Executive plays a pivotal role in supporting the delivery of integrated marketing, brand, campaign, and event initiatives across the Supercars season. This position works across brand management, campaign coordination, event marketing execution, creative briefing and stakeholder management.
The role is ideal for a highly organised and energetic marketer who enjoys working in a fast‑paced sports and entertainment environment, has strong communication skills, and thrives when managing multiple projects involving diverse internal and external stakeholders.
